Tarrant County Property Tax

Tarrant County is the third largest county in Texas and has the highest number of taxable property accounts in the state. Basically, Tarrant county property tax is calculated through an appraisal process. In general, property taxes are calculated by multiplying a tax rate by the assessed value of a home.
